In support of our mission to enhance the quality of life for South Carolinians by advocating for public health, SCDPH is seeking a Nutrition Program Specialist.

This role is perfect for individuals passionate about nutrition education and counseling, breastfeeding advocacy, and empowering families through community nutrition initiatives.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Conduct comprehensive nutrition evaluations to determine participant eligibility for the Women, Infants, & Children (WIC) Program, including thorough health history, dietary assessments, anthropometric measurements, and risk status evaluations.
  • Design personalized WIC food packages.
  • Document high-risk participant evaluations using SOAP Note format and provide tailored nutrition follow-ups for low-risk participants. Identify and refer high-risk participants to a Registered Dietitian Nutritionist.
  • Create, implement, and assess nutrition education, training, and counseling for low-risk participants. Direct low-risk participants to online nutrition education resources.
  • Facilitate breastfeeding support and promotion for pregnant and breastfeeding participants. Screen all pregnant and breastfeeding participants and refer them to appropriate care levels. Distribute and monitor breastfeeding supplies.
  • Educate participants about formula options and provide support regarding WIC contract and List I special formulas.
  • Oversee WIC contract and special formulas as assigned. Refer participants on List II special formulas and metabolic formulas to the Registered Dietitian.
  • Actively engage as a member of a multidisciplinary WIC team in clinic/class scheduling, caseload management, and outreach efforts.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ned.
Minimum and Additional Requirements

State Minimum Requirements: A bachelor's degree in home economics, human ecology, dietetics, or a related field.

Agency Additional Requirements: A bachelor's degree in nutrition, food sciences, biology, public health, health education, or a related field, or an associate degree in applied science, child development, or a related field with at least two years of relevant nutrition experience in a clinical, public health, or institutional setting may be accepted upon HR approval. Relevant professional nutrition experience may substitute for educational requirements upon Human Resources' approval.

Must possess or be willing to acquire the specialized skills necessary for collecting screening information and anthropometric measurements.

Benefits for State Employees

The state of South Carolina offers eligible employees generous benefits, including health and dental insurance; retirement and savings plan options; and paid vacation and sick leave. Plus, work-life balance programs such as telecommuting and flexible work schedules are available to employees of some state agencies.

Insurance Benefits
Eligible employees may enroll in health insurance, which includes prescription coverage and wellness benefits. Other available insurance benefits include dental, vision, term life insurance, long term disability, and flexible spending accounts for health and child care expenses.

Retirement Benefits
State employees are also offered retirement plan options, including defined benefit and defined contribution plans. Additionally, eligible employees may elect to participate in the South Carolina Deferred Compensation Program, which is a voluntary, supplemental retirement savings plan offering 401(k) and 457 plan options.

Workplace Benefits
State employees may also be eligible for other benefits, including tuition assistance; holiday, annual and sick leave; and discounts on purchases, travel, and more.

Note: The benefits above are available to most state employees, with the exception of those in temporary positions. Employees in temporary grant and time-limited positions may be eligible for all, some, or none of these benefits as benefits are associated with each position type. For these positions, contact the hiring agency to determine what benefits may be available.
